Platelet-Rich Plasma (PRP) Treatment: Utilizing Your Body's Healing Power

Platelet-rich plasma treatment stands as one of one of the most extensively researched and scientifically tried and tested regenerative medicine treatments available today. This innovative procedure includes extracting a small sample of your blood, processing it to focus the platelets and growth aspects, and then infusing this focused remedy directly into the affected location. The result is a powerful recovery alcoholic drink which contains up to ten times the normal concentration of development elements located in normal blood.

The platelets in PRP have countless bioactive healthy proteins and development elements that play critical functions in tissue repair service and regeneration. These include platelet-derived growth factor (PDGF), changing development factor-beta (TGF-β& beta;-RRB-, vascular endothelial growth variable (VEGF), and insulin-like growth factor (IGF). When focused and delivered to hurt tissues, these elements stimulate mobile spreading, improve collagen production, promote blood vessel development, and reduce inflammation.

PRP treatment has actually shown amazing success in dealing with a variety of problems, including osteo arthritis, ligament injuries, tendon sprains, muscle mass stress, and persistent injuries. The treatment is minimally invasive, usually performed in an office setting, and uses your very own blood, eliminating the risk of allergies or disease transmission. Many clients experience substantial discomfort reduction and boosted feature within weeks of treatment, with advantages commonly lasting for months or perhaps years.

Stem Cell Treatment: Regrowing Tissues at the Mobile Level

Stem cell therapy represents the peak of regenerative medicine, providing the possible to literally regrow broken cells by introducing cells with the ability of differentiating into numerous cell kinds needed for repair work. These amazing cells possess the one-of-a-kind capability to self-renew and set apart into specialized cell kinds, making them important tools for dealing with degenerative conditions and injuries that were previously considered untreatable.

There are several sorts of stem cells used in regenerative medicine, each with distinct features and applications. Mesenchymal stem cells, stemmed from sources such as bone marrow or adipose tissue, have actually revealed specific assurance in dealing with musculoskeletal conditions. These cells can set apart into bone, cartilage, muscular tissue, and connective tissue cells, making them suitable for treating joint inflammation, cartilage material flaws, and other orthopedic conditions.

The healing possibility of stem cell treatment expands much beyond easy tissue replacement. These cells additionally produce numerous growth aspects, cytokines, and various other bioactive particles that create a desirable environment for healing. This paracrine impact helps in reducing inflammation, advertise angiogenesis (development of new members vessels), and recruit the body's very own fixing cells to the therapy site. The combination of straight cellular substitute and indirect healing enhancement makes stem cell treatment distinctly powerful.

The Science Behind Tissue Regrowth and Healing

Understanding the clinical concepts underlying regenerative medicine helps clarify why these treatments are so efficient and why they represent such a significant innovation over conventional treatments. At the cellular degree, tissue regeneration includes intricate communications in between various cell types, signifying molecules, and structural components that collaborate to recover regular tissue design and function.

The healing procedure starts with swelling, which, while often seen adversely, is actually a critical first step in cells repair work. Throughout this stage, immune cells move to the injury website to clear debris and release signaling particles that start the repair service process. Growth elements and cytokines are released, producing a biochemical environment that promotes cell spreading and differentiation. Regenerative medicine therapies enhance this all-natural procedure by providing added development variables and cells to accelerate and maximize healing.

Angiogenesis, the development of new members vessels, plays a crucial role in effective tissue regrowth. Without ample blood supply, cells can not obtain the oxygen and nutrients necessary for recovery. Many regenerative medicine treatments specifically advertise angiogenesis with the shipment of vascular growth elements, guaranteeing that freshly restored tissues have the blood supply needed to make it through and thrive.

The extracellular matrix, an intricate network of proteins and other molecules that provides architectural support to tissues, must likewise be restored during regeneration. Regenerative treatments help stimulate the production of key matrix elements such as collagen and elastin, which are crucial for tissue stamina and flexibility. This thorough technique to cells regrowth—-- attending to mobile, vascular, and structural components—-- clarifies why regenerative medicine commonly accomplishes remarkable end results compared to treatments that target only one facet of the recovery process.
